Transaction 510e7055dbd4c6801e43edd9440813f4ac62de2b3690f7159190fc4cb5991dae
2 Input
2 Outputs
- 510e7055dbd4c6801e43edd9440813f4ac62de2b3690f7159190fc4cb5991dae:0
- 510e7055dbd4c6801e43edd9440813f4ac62de2b3690f7159190fc4cb5991dae:1
value 221150000
address 13eFq1xoj4wx7TA33XkXbBcbxgfeHAoGRN
value 167540700
address 18wcahFWZ2X8vsA2Z3puyNNLbRucg4KSNa